1: # The LearningOnline Network with CAPA
2: # Construct and maintain state and binary representation of course for user
3: #

30: package Apache::lonuserstate;
31:
32: # ------------------------------------------------- modules used by this module
33: use strict;
34: use HTML::TokeParser;
35: use Apache::lonnet;
36: use Apache::lonlocal;
37: use Apache::loncommon();
38: use GDBM_File;
39: use Apache::lonmsg;
40: use Safe;
41: use Safe::Hole;
42: use Opcode;
43: use Apache::lonenc;
44: use Fcntl qw(:flock);
45: use LONCAPA;
46:
47:
48: # ---------------------------------------------------- Globals for this package
49:
50: my $pc; # Package counter
51: my %hash; # The big tied hash
52: my %parmhash;# The hash with the parameters
53: my @cond; # Array with all of the conditions
54: my $errtext; # variable with all errors
55: my $retfrid; # variable with the very first RID in the course
56: my $retfurl; # first URL
57: my %randompick; # randomly picked resources
58: my %randompickseed; # optional seed for randomly picking resources
59: my %encurl; # URLs in this folder are supposed to be encrypted
60: my %hiddenurl; # this URL (or complete folder) is supposed to be hidden
61:
62: # ----------------------------------- Remove version from URL and store in hash
63:
64: sub versiontrack {
65: my $uri=shift;
66: if ($uri=~/\.(\d+)\.\w+$/) {
67: my $version=$1;
68: $uri=~s/\.\d+\.(\w+)$/\.$1/;
69: unless ($hash{'version_'.$uri}) {
70: $hash{'version_'.$uri}=$version;
71: }
72: }
73: return $uri;
74: }
75:
76: # -------------------------------------------------------------- Put in version
77:
78: sub putinversion {
79: my $uri=shift;
80: my $key=$env{'request.course.id'}.'_'.&Apache::lonnet::clutter($uri);
81: if ($hash{'version_'.$uri}) {
82: my $version=$hash{'version_'.$uri};
83: if ($version eq 'mostrecent') { return $uri; }
84: if ($version eq &Apache::lonnet::getversion(
85: &Apache::lonnet::filelocation('',$uri)))
86: { return $uri; }
87: $uri=~s/\.(\w+)$/\.$version\.$1/;
88: }
89: &Apache::lonnet::do_cache_new('courseresversion',$key,&Apache::lonnet::declutter($uri),600);
90: return $uri;
91: }
92:
93: # ----------------------------------------- Processing versions file for course
94:
95: sub processversionfile {
96: my %cenv=@_;
97: my %versions=&Apache::lonnet::dump('resourceversions',
98: $cenv{'domain'},
99: $cenv{'num'});
100: foreach my $ver (keys(%versions)) {
101: if ($ver=~/^error\:/) { return; }
102: $hash{'version_'.$ver}=$versions{$ver};
103: }
104: }

323: # --------------------------------------------------------- Simplify expression
324:
325: sub simplify {
326: my $expression=shift;
327: # (0&1) = 1
328: $expression=~s/\(0\&([_\.\d]+)\)/$1/g;
329: # (8)=8
330: $expression=~s/\(([_\.\d]+)\)/$1/g;
331: # 8&8=8
332: $expression=~s/([^_\.\d])([_\.\d]+)\&\2([^_\.\d])/$1$2$3/g;
333: # 8|8=8
334: $expression=~s/([^_\.\d])([_\.\d]+)\|\2([^_\.\d])/$1$2$3/g;
335: # (5&3)&4=5&3&4
336: $expression=~s/\(([_\.\d]+)((?:\&[_\.\d]+)+)\)\&([_\.\d]+[^_\.\d])/$1$2\&$3/g;
337: # (((5&3)|(4&6)))=((5&3)|(4&6))
338: $expression=~
339: s/\((\(\([_\.\d]+(?:\&[_\.\d]+)*\)(?:\|\([_\.\d]+(?:\&[_\.\d]+)*\))+\))\)/$1/g;
340: # ((5&3)|(4&6))|(1&2)=(5&3)|(4&6)|(1&2)
341: $expression=~
342: s/\((\([_\.\d]+(?:\&[_\.\d]+)*\))((?:\|\([_\.\d]+(?:\&[_\.\d]+)*\))+)\)\|(\([_\.\d]+(?:\&[_\.\d]+)*\))/\($1$2\|$3\)/g;
343: return $expression;
344: }

689: # ------------------------------------------------------- Evaluate state string
690:
691: sub evalstate {
692: my $fn=$env{'request.course.fn'}.'.state';
693: my $state='';
694: if (-e $fn) {
695: my @conditions=();
696: {
697: open(my $fh,"<$fn");
698: @conditions=<$fh>;
699: close($fh);
700: }
701: my $safeeval = new Safe;
702: my $safehole = new Safe::Hole;
703: $safeeval->permit("entereval");
704: $safeeval->permit(":base_math");
705: $safeeval->deny(":base_io");
706: $safehole->wrap(\&Apache::lonnet::EXT,$safeeval,'&EXT');
707: foreach my $line (@conditions) {
708: chomp($line);
709: my ($condition,$weight)=split(/\:/,$line);
710: if ($safeeval->reval($condition)) {
711: if ($weight eq 'force') {
712: $state.='3';
713: } else {
714: $state.='2';
715: }
716: } else {
717: if ($weight eq 'stop') {
718: $state.='0';
719: } else {
720: $state.='1';
721: }
722: }
723: }
724: }
725: &Apache::lonnet::appenv('user.state.'.$env{'request.course.id'} => $state);
726: return $state;
727: }
